linux bitcoin不同步,BitCoin Core 全节点同步太慢的解决方法

修改data文件和blocks区块文件的路径

要想更快加速同步的方法,最好将data文件放到SSD的硬盘里面,没有SSD硬盘的放速度快点的SSD的U盘也行。data文件其实只需要3个多G,区块文件才需要200多G。 区块文件没必要放SSD硬盘,浪费资源,放机械硬盘就可以了。本方法也同样适用于移动你的data文件到一个新电脑,本人亲自测试过,新电脑不需要重新同步。下面介绍一下,如何移动你的data文件和区块文件。

1、移出blocks文件

首先要先关闭程序。假设你的数据目录原来在d:\bitcoindata\下面。

先创建一个d:\bitcoin_chaindata\目录。 然后把d:\bitcoindata\blocks目录移动到d:\bitcoin_chaindata\下面。 然后在d:\bitcoindata\下在建立一个blocks目录,把d:\bitcoin_chaindata\blocks\index 目录移动到d:\bitcoindata\blocks\下面。

这样,分离blocks数据的任务就完成了。

2、移动data文件到SSD中

接下来如果你C盘是SSD,那么在C盘下建立一个c:\bitcoin_data\目录,把d:\bitcoindata\下所有文件都copy到c:\bitcoin_data\下面。data目录的移动也完成了。

3、配置data和chains目录的改动

接下来就是配置,更改data目录和blocks目录在bitcoin.conf也可以实现。但我还是告诉大家简单的方法。

右键点击bitcoin core(64-bit)这个快捷图标,再点击属性。就会跳出下面的界面。

2730c3e9f917f57f7e61b1fab67c598e.png

在目标这个地方,原来是”C:\Program

Files\Bitcoin\bitcoin-qt.exe”, 在其后面增加-datadir=C:\bitcoin_data

-blocksdir=D:\bitcoin_chaindata 。-datadir前面要有空格。“C:\Program Files\Bitcoin\bitcoin-qt.exe”

-datadir=C:\bitcoin_data -blocksdir=D:\bitcoin_chaindata 。 点击确认就可以了。

下次点击bitcoin core启动,你同步里面加速了。

  • 1
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值